We are looking for an experienced, data-driven Sr. Benefits Analyst to manage our defined benefit (DB) administration and oversight for the Honeywell Retirement plans, providing accurate reviews and outputs in compliance with plan rules, funding, legislative requirements, and internal practices in the U.S. and Puerto Rico. You will need to partner with our outsourced administrator on the processing of the most complex calculations for plans, analyzing data and interpreting plan rules to ensure the calculations are accurate. Will manage cases supporting the resolution of inquiries, escalations, errors, and requests from participants, such as hourly manufacturing workers, salaried workers, retired participants, and top Executive Officers. Leads a range of projects that have ahigh visibility and vary in scope and complexity for ongoing work operations, compliance, audits, and vendor management improvements.

 

In this role, you are providing operational support to standard work, delivering standardized and self-service HR solutions, and driving digital transformation initiatives forward. You will have a significant impact on optimizing HR processes, enhancing employee experience, and driving HR's digital transformation journey, contributing to the success and effectiveness of Honeywell's overall operations.

 

You will report to our Benefits Director and work out of our Charlotte, NC location on a hybrid basis. Note: for the first 90 days, New Hires must be prepared to work 100% onsite M-F.

 

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Provide end-to-end execution of defined benefit pension processes, ensure up to date and accurate documentation, leverage historical databases to collect data, drive continuous improvement focusing on key initiatives of an excellent user experience ensuring right and fast support.
  • Manage suppliers to ensure quality administration of plans and the customer experience, payments, audit completion, execution of reporting and filings, with vendors such as, Conduent and Northern Trust. Participate in quarterly service reviews.
  • Stay up to date with regulatory changes in the industry and help us transition into the future as seamlessly as possible. Apply legislation and regulations, including but not limited to IRS, DOL, and ERISA, when preparing, analyzing, and interpreting plan documents, summaries of plan provisions, and related plan materials.
  • Assists with audits and preparations of annual filings. Work with internal and external partners on compliance and other related matters. Participate in merger and acquisition activities to ensure compliance.
  • Identify operational errors and areas of weakness in plan operations, support audit reports and relevant supporting documentation to present findings and improvements to leadership. Assist with developing corrective action strategies.
  • Manage payroll reconciliations, escalations, leveraging multiple data sources, conducting data analysis, communicating findings, and making recommendations.
  • Proactively identify problems and trends, along with solutions, which might be leading to increased volume of escalations or issues.
  • Manage the claims and appeals process ensuring timely and accurate responses back to participants.
  • Maintain a robust data intelligence infrastructure, ensuring the accuracy, accessibility, and timely sharing of information among business professionals to support informed decision making and drive business success.
  • Collaborate in project planning, execution, and effective communication of information throughout the organization to drive successful project outcomes and facilitate seamless business operations.
  • Support year-end and mid-year non-discrimination testing as required by the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) to ensure compliance.
